How the Thickening Shampoo Works for Fine Hair


"Thickening" does not mean the shampoo changes the actual diameter of your hair strands. It means the formula is designed to add volume and body, especially at the roots. A thickening shampoo usually removes excess oil and buildup so that fine hair can lift easily. It may also contain botanical extracts that coat the hair lightly and make it look denser. In this case, the Tea Tree Lemon Sage line relies on a refreshing botanical cleanser rather than a waxy coating. That is one reason I trust this Tea Tree Lemon Sage Shampoo for Fine Hair. It gives my fine hair body, but my hair still feels like hair. Some cheap volumizing shampoos leave a stiff or sticky residue; this one does not.

Practical Advice: Bottle Cap and Usage


The product information and reviews also mention something small but important: the bottle cap can become loose. Several customers mentioned this issue. I had no major leak, but I always keep the bottle upright and close the cap tightly after every use. If you are traveling, I recommend putting the bottle in a plastic bag just in case. When you use the shampoo, use an amount that matches your hair length. For fine, mid-back hair, a quarter-sized amount is enough. Massage it into the scalp, let the lather sit for a minute, then rinse. Follow with the Tea Tree Lemon Sage Thickening Conditioner on the middle and ends of your hair. This simple routine helped me get the most benefit from this Tea Tree Lemon Sage Shampoo for Fine Hair.
